Real Estate Venture
Every property in Fable that's not already for sale (noted by a For Sale sign out front) is owned by someone in the town. That person may not be in town at that moment, as people do travel, but generally you can find the owner nearby. Should that person die, his or her property immediately goes on the market. Are you thinking what I'm thinking?
Now you may be smart enough to realize that guards aren't exactly going to let you kill people and take their property -- not in the town proper anyway. But you have two options. First, you can be stealthy and kill people when guards and witnesses are not around. And if you're impatient, like I am, you can convince people to follow you out of town. With enough renown or if the NPC takes a liking to your type of character, use the Follow expression and they will indeed follow you out of down and into the wilderness where you can turn on them and pop them like a zit with a fireball. The moment they die, a message flashes on screen, "A new property has gone on the market." It's okay to laugh, you didn't know him very well anyway.
There's no limit to how much you can own, so you can in fact buy an entire town with enough diligence. But properties can be upgraded just like your character. When you get a place, it's gonna be pretty bare. But you can spend cash anytime you drop by and continually upgrade your place from shack to mansion. Then you can sell off your property for big bucks. While some may end this venture right there, a smart person would then turn around and kill the new owner and repurchase the property for cheap.
